Accountancy Practice Jobs in Crawley: A Comprehensive Guide If you are looking for a career in accountancy, then there are many job opportunities available in Crawley. Accountancy practice jobs are in high demand in the area and there are several firms that are currently hiring. But before you start your job search, it is important to understand what accountancy practice jobs entail and what skills are required to be successful in this field. What are Accountancy Practice Jobs? Accountancy practice jobs are positions within a firm that provides accounting services to clients. These services may include tax preparation, financial statement preparation, audit and assurance, and advisory services. Accountancy practices may serve a wide variety of clients, including individuals, small businesses, and large corporations. Accountancy practice jobs typically involve working in a team environment and collaborating with other professionals, such as tax specialists and auditors. These positions require strong analytical and critical thinking skills, as well as the ability to work under pressure and meet tight deadlines. What Skills are Required for Accountancy Practice Jobs? To be successful in an accountancy practice job, you will need to possess a variety of skills. These include: 1. Strong analytical and critical thinking skills: You will need to be able to analyze financial data and identify patterns and trends. 2. Attention to detail: Accountancy practice jobs require a high level of accuracy, as even small errors can have significant consequences. 3. Time management: You will need to be able to manage your time effectively and prioritize tasks to meet tight deadlines. 4. Communication skills: You will need to be able to communicate effectively with clients and colleagues, both verbally and in writing. 5. Teamwork: You will need to be able to work effectively in a team environment and collaborate with other professionals. 6. Technical skills: You will need to have a strong understanding of accounting principles and be proficient in using accounting software. What Accountancy Practice Jobs are Available in Crawley? How to Apply for Accountancy Practice Jobs in Crawley To apply for accountancy practice jobs in Crawley, you will typically need to have a degree in accounting or a related field, as well as professional qualifications such as ACA, ACCA, or CIMA. You will also need to have relevant work experience, either through internships or previous employment. To apply for a job, you will need to submit a CV and cover letter to the hiring firm. Your CV should highlight your relevant skills and experience, while your cover letter should explain why you are interested in the position and what you can bring to the role. As an employee, receiving a redundancy notice can be a daunting and stressful experience. The prospect of losing your job can be overwhelming, and the process of navigating the redundancy procedures can be confusing and complicated. Fortunately, the Advisory, Conciliation and Arbitration Service (ACAS) provides helpful resources and guidance for employees facing redundancy, including a template for a job at risk of redundancy letter. What is a job at risk of redundancy letter? A job at risk of redundancy letter is a formal communication from an employer to an employee, notifying them that their position is being considered for redundancy. This letter is typically the first step in the redundancy process, and it should outline the reasons why the employee's job is at risk, what options are available, and what support is available to the employee. Why might an employer issue a job at risk of redundancy letter? Employers may issue a job at risk of redundancy letter for a variety of reasons, including: - Business restructuring: If a company is undergoing significant changes, such as merging with another company or reorganizing its operations, some roles may become redundant. - Economic downturn: In times of economic uncertainty or recession, companies may need to reduce their workforce to cut costs. - Technological advances: As technology continues to evolve, some roles may become obsolete or automated, leading to redundancies. What should be included in a job at risk of redundancy letter? ACAS provides a useful template for a job at risk of redundancy letter, which includes the following information: - The reason for the letter: The letter should clearly state that the employee's job is at risk of redundancy and explain why. - The consultation process: The letter should outline the consultation process that will take place, including when and how the employee will be consulted. - The selection criteria: If the employer needs to select employees for redundancy, the letter should detail the criteria that will be used, such as length of service, skills or performance. - Alternative options: The letter should explain the alternatives to redundancy that are available, such as redeployment or reduced hours. - Support available: The letter should explain the support that is available to the employee during the redundancy process, such as access to training or outplacement services. - Next steps: The letter should outline the next steps in the redundancy process, including when the employee will receive further updates. How should an employee respond to a job at risk of redundancy letter? Receiving a job at risk of redundancy letter can be a difficult and emotional experience, but it's important for employees to respond in a professional and constructive manner. Some tips for responding to a job at risk of redundancy letter include: - Seeking advice: Employees should seek advice from their union representative or a legal professional to understand their rights and options. - Asking questions: Employees should ask their employer for more information about the reasons for the redundancy, the selection criteria and the alternatives to redundancy. - Exploring alternatives: Employees should consider whether they might be able to work in a different role within the company, or whether they might be able to reduce their hours or take a sabbatical. - Updating their CV: Employees should update their CV and start to think about their next steps, such as applying for other jobs or setting up their own business. - Taking care of themselves: Redundancy can be a stressful and emotional experience, so employees should take care of their mental and physical health by seeking support from friends, family or a healthcare professional if needed. In conclusion, receiving a job at risk of redundancy letter can be a challenging experience for employees, but it's important to remember that there are resources and support available. The ACAS template for a job at risk of redundancy letter provides a useful starting point for employers to communicate with their employees, and employees should respond in a professional and constructive manner, seeking advice and exploring their options. By working together, employers and employees can navigate the redundancy process in a way that is fair, transparent and respectful.
